The results of a power spectrum analysis of a train of 3968 pulses received from PSR 1919+21 at 1420 MHz are presented. It is shown that the P subscript 3 period of this pulsar may vary in a quasi-periodic manner on the timescale of about 30 min, within a narrow range of values corresponding to the width of the P subscript 3 feature in the average power spectrum. Some theoretical implications of this new effect are discussed.
